Biographical history

Hyrco and Anna Romaniuk came to Canada with their family from Halychyna in 1898. The family, consisting of Yelena, Stefen, and Nastia, settled in the Wostok area to homestead. Yelena married in 1911 and had three surviving daughters: Pearl, Annie, and Jane. In 1943, Yelena and her family retired to Andrew, Alberta. While in Andrew, Yelena ran a dress shop until 1962.

Custodial history

Eli and Mary Romaniuk allowed the Ukrainian Cultural Heritage Village to copy material comprising PR1981.0095. In 1981, the UCHV transferred the material to the Provincial Archives of Alberta (PAA). In 1987, Harry Romaniuk donated the material comprising PR1987.0109 to the PAA.

Scope and content

The fonds consists of a copy of a photograph taken by Jane Romaniuk circa 1944 featuring the Romaniuk Family on a verandah of the Pickell House in Andrew, Alberta; and a photograph of members of the Romaniuk family circa 1930.
